Step 1: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
Step 2: Spray baking sheet with nonstick cooking spray.
Step 3: Combine fl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t in a mixing bowl.
Step 4: Using a pastry blender or fork, cut in butter until m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
Step 5: In a separate bowl, beat together eggs, milk, and 1 tbsp. instant coffee.
Step 6: Add to dry ingredients, mixing until just blended.
Step 7: Stir in hazelnuts.
Step 8: On a lightly floured surface, knead the dough 5-6 times, but not too much or it makes the dough tough.
Step 9: Cut the dough into three parts; cut each part into fourths.
Step 10: Pat each part into a patty or roll and place on baking sheet.
Step 11: Bake at 425 degrees F. for 10-12 minutes or until light golden.
Step 12: Remove from baking sheet and cool on wire rack.
Step 13: Prepare glaze by mixing 1 tbsp. water with 1/4 tsp. instant coffee; add 1/2 cup powdered sugar, stirring until well blended.
Step 14: Drizzle over scones with a spoon, adjusting consistency, if necessary, with a little water or more sugar.
